Yeah i've read and re-read those posts. Talked to Shari and talked to all-rite about the same custom tank. I was hoping getting the same tank from the allrite might be cheaper because they had already done one. No such luck, they were asking $450+, im a poor grad student and that just doesn't cut it I talked to inca they do have a 27x27x6 that has a radius on it for about $150, but i would have to make sure that it would fit the street side - front corner of the trailer. We'll see.

I actually ordered my grey water from INCA. They're very reasonable in price with the non-custom tanks and Bill is super nice.
